PowerStore:既存のクラスターに別のアプライアンスを追加しようとすると失敗する
Summary: ユーザーが新しいアプライアンスをクラスターに追加する前に、そのアプライアンスのPowerStore Managerにログインしようとすると、既存のクラスターに別のアプライアンスを追加できないことがあります。
This article applies to
This article does not apply to
This article is not tied to any specific product.
Not all product versions are identified in this article.
Symptoms
アプライアンスを既存のクラスターに追加しようとすると、次のエラー コードで失敗する場合があります。
PowerStore Managerには、次のように表示されます。
- Clustering operation failed, Reason: Platform error: java.lang.Integer cannot be cast to java.lang.Long (0xE0C010010013).
- Clustering operation failed, Reason: java.lang.Integer cannot be cast to java.lang.Long (0xE0C010010013).
- Failed to delete target port group, Reason: java.lang.Integer cannot be cast to java.lang.Long (0xE0C01001000E).
- The system encountered unexpected backend errors.Please contact support. (0xE0101001000C).
PowerStore Managerには、次のように表示されます。
Cause
この問題は、アプライアンスをクラスターに追加する前に、サービス ポートを介して新しいアプライアンスのPowerStore Manager (UI)にアクセスしようとすると発生します。
この問題は、ロックボックス作成のタイムスタンプがjoinClusterイベントのタイムスタンプより前である場合に発生します。
- 新しいアプライアンスのUIへのログインを試行すると、PATCHリクエストが/api/rest/local_user/1(ユーザー管理者)に送信されたことを示すログ行が表示されます。
| Apr 03 03:09:56 xxxxx-A control-path[20956]: 2021-04-03 03:09:56.310 [] [INFO] [com.emc.bedrock.http.HttpVerticle|vert.x-eventloop-thread-0] Request ID: 28fc0ae7-284d-415e-b5b9-974be4780301.Client IP: xx.xx.xx.xx.Server IP: xx.xx.xx.xx Application type: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/xx Safari/xx Method: PATCH.Processing route: /api/rest/local_user/1. |
- これは、ログイン後に最初にユーザーに表示される画面で、パスワードの変更を求める画面です。
- ユーザーが[Cancel]をクリックして、変更しない場合でも、新しいロックボックスが作成され、管理者アカウントのパスワードに関連する操作がログに表示されます。このロックボックスは、システムの変更または修正としてカウントされるため、アプライアンスはクラスターに追加されません。
| Apr 03 03:09:56 xxxxx-A CryptoApi[11782]: Lockbox does not exist, create one. Apr 03 03:10:00 xxxxx-A CryptoApi[11782]: Successfully created and initialized the lockbox. Apr 03 03:10:00 xxxxx-A CryptoApi[11782]: crypto_is_initialized: CryptoApi is already initialized Apr 03 03:10:00 xxxxx-A CryptoApi[11782]: crypto_init: Library is already initialized, skipping initialization process Apr 03 03:10:00 xxxxx-A CryptoApi[11782]: crypto_get_default_key_from_lb: key does not exist Apr 03 03:10:00 xxxxx-A CryptoApi[11782]: crypto_is_initialized: CryptoApi is not initialized, filename is null Apr 03 03:10:00 xxxxx-A CryptoApi[11782]: Successfully set the environment.API version: 1.0.4 |
この問題は、ロックボックス作成のタイムスタンプがjoinClusterイベントのタイムスタンプより前である場合に発生します。
Resolution
この問題は、PowerStoreOS 2.1.0.0以降で対処されています。できるだけ早くアップデートすることをお勧めします。
PowerStoreOS 2.1.0.0より前のバージョンの場合:
新しいアプライアンスは、クラスターに再度追加する前に、正常な工場出荷時の状態に戻す必要があります。
アプライアンスが見つからない場合は、SSH経由でのみ新しいアプライアンスにログインしてステータスを確認できます(コマンド例:svc_diag list --icw_hardware)。新しいアプライアンスを追加できない場合は、Dell EMCテクニカル サポートまたは認定サービス担当者に連絡し、このナレッジベース記事IDをお知らせください。
PowerStoreOS 2.1.0.0より前のバージョンの場合:
新しいアプライアンスは、クラスターに再度追加する前に、正常な工場出荷時の状態に戻す必要があります。
- 新しいアプライアンスを再初期化して、工場出荷時の状態に戻します。詳細については、次のDell KB記事を参照してください。記事番号180964:PowerStore:svc_factory_resetコマンドを使用してPowerStoreシステムを工場出荷時の状態に再初期化する方法」。
- 1時間以上経過してから、新しいアプライアンスをクラスターに追加します。
- 新しいアプライアンスのUIにログインしないでください。
- 既存のクラスターから[Add Appliance Wizard]を実行します。
アプライアンスが見つからない場合は、SSH経由でのみ新しいアプライアンスにログインしてステータスを確認できます(コマンド例:svc_diag list --icw_hardware)。新しいアプライアンスを追加できない場合は、Dell EMCテクニカル サポートまたは認定サービス担当者に連絡し、このナレッジベース記事IDをお知らせください。
Affected Products
PowerStoreArticle Properties
Article Number: 000185006
Article Type: Solution
Last Modified: 15 Sep 2022
Version: 4
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.